Emmerdale actress Leah Bracknell is to take a break from the ITV1 soap to qualify as a yoga teacher.
Bracknell, 40, who plays vet Zoe Tate, will leave in the autumn in a dramatic storyline to take nine months off.
"I am looking forward to spending some time with my family and having the opportunity to pursue other projects," the mother-of-two said.
"I will also be finishing my teaching diploma in yoga which is something I am passionate about," she added.
Bracknell released an exercise video last year.
She has played Zoe for 15 years, and has been at the centre of some of the soap's most dramatic storylines, including an affair with Charity Dingle in 2001 and a schizophrenic breakdown the following year.
The lesbian vet fell pregnant following her breakdown, and was shocked to discover the father of her baby was womaniser Scott Windsor.
Series producer Kath Beedles said: "Leah is an exceptional actress and has made a huge contribution to Emmerdale's ongoing success. We wish her all the best for her well-earned break and look forward to welcoming her back in the future."
